Abstract
The study focuses on the analysis of ‘z-score’ and checking the impact of economic as well as firm parameters on the former. The exploratory study applies the period from 2018–19 to 2022–23. The study utilises multiple regression analysis, the result indicates that, GDP (Gross Domestic Product) and CPI (Consumer Price Index) has influence on the ‘z-score’ of the selective public banks. The Age of the firm has also slight of the influence on ‘z-score’. The study is helpful for understanding the current status-quo of the public sector banks of the India. The overall improvement has been marked in every selected bank for the study.
